  7. The Ventures, American musical group that gained fame with its instrumental interpretations of pop hits and that served as a prototype for guitar-based rock groups. Formed in the Seattle area in 1958, the group is best known for the song ‘Walk—Don’t Run’ and the theme for the TV series Hawaii Five-O.
